- The comorbidities chosen in the first group of patients, such as previous cardiovascular disease, arteriopathy and diabetes, are clearly factors related to a poor prognosis in COVID-19 infection. This was absolutely clear in the statistical results. Including the higher male risk of complications and worse outcome. Finally, the authors present a very interesting work, but they need to decide if the objective of this study is to demonstrate it is a successful mathematical model, or they want to demonstrate the factors of a worse outcome. The latter have already been described in many other previous clinical works.

In this way, I believe that the study should be written again in a clear, objective way and that what is intended to be demonstrated in this study is clearly defined.

Answer: We agree with the reviewer that our aim could be defined (even) more clearly in the manuscript. The model that we developed is not intended to be used as a clinical prediction algorithm. Contrarily, the mathematical model served only as a tool to explore and quantify the incremental predictive value on top of age and sex of concurrent cardiovascular disease on prognosis of community people with COVID-19. For that purpose, we used state-of-the-art methodological techniques including external validation, in order to be able to draw valid conclusions on the predictive value of cardiovascular disease. Thereby, our model can be used to illustrate the probability of experiencing an unfavorable outcome in community people with COVID-19, whereby our model estimates these probabilities conditional on the presence (or absence) of (the number of) cardiovascular comorbidities, age and sex.

We also agree that indeed for secondary care COVID-19 patients the predictive value of cardiovascular disease has already been studied in numerous studies. However, even after almost two years of COVID-19 research, such a predictive effect was not yet formally evaluated in community people with COVID-19. The exploration of this incremental value of cardiovascular comorbidity on COVID-19 prognosis in this domain obviously is needed as well because the large majority (95% or more) of patients with COVID-19 will not need hospitalisation. Given the large differences in case mix between primary and secondary care a study as ours was obligatory. Moreover, the early identification of high-risk patients in primary care has paramount practical and prognostic impact because risks may be mitigated in these patients e.g. by close monitoring or the prescription of e.g. novel virus inhibitors.

To present our aims more clearly in the manuscript, we have made a few adjustments to our formulation of the research question in the introduction and to our conclusion. Furthermore, we have added the intended use of the prediction model (as a mathematical tool only) to our strengths and limitation section of the discussion. All changes are marked using track changes.

Reviewer #3: This was a well written and thought-provoking article. Within the limitations the authors should clarify that while the factors included were associated with hospital referral, this is an observational study and potential confounders should be considered.

As a clinician, I am unable to comment on the accuracy of the statistical analyses performed.

Answer: Indeed, cardiovascular disease and/or diabetes are not the only predictors of clinical deterioration in COVID-19 patients. From studies mainly performed in the secondary care COVID-19 domain we know that sex and age are the strongest predictors in predicting adverse COVID-19 outcomes, and that additionally also e.g. the use of immunosuppressant medication could be considered, amongst other predictors described in the literature. (Ref: https://www.bmj.com/content/369/bmj.m1328)

However, cardiovascular disease has been shown to be an important predictor of clinical deterioration in secondary care COVID-19 patients. Our aim was to explore whether this also holds in community people. The model that we developed was used to firmly illustrate (and confirm) this predictive value of cardiovascular disease on top of age and sex in primary care COVID-19 patients. We therefore only included age, sex and cardiovascular disease as predictors. Adjustments have been made to further clarify our aim as has been described in the answer to the second question by reviewer 2.

Finally, confounding will not be an issue in our work as our aim was only prognostic: to quantify the prognostic impact of these concurrent comorbidities on the prognosis of COVID-19 in primary care. Our aim was not to explore a causal relationship between cardiovascular disease and COVID-19 complications. This was done deliberately as we believe quantifying this prognostic impact on – as was done in our study – the probability of hospital referral in patients with COVID-19 seems clinically more relevant than an exploration of underlying causal mechanisms or pathways.
